This was my husband's and I first cruise. We picked this cruise for the ports, as we don't care that much about the ship features as we do about seeing new places in the world. Overall I was very satisfied with this cruise.

Embarkation: Easy Easy Easy. We arrived around noon, and were on the ship within about 15 minutes. Our room wasn't ready until 1, so we walked around and explored for a little bit before heading to our room.

Room: We had a rear facing aft cabin on deck 7. It was a superior balcony room. From what I can tell the rear facing balconies were about twice as big as a normal balcony. We had room from 2 lounges, a table and 2 normal chairs. The regular balconies only have room for 2 chairs and table, no loungers. We loved having a balcony and would never book another cruise without one. We loved leaving the sliding door open at night for a fresh ocean breeze and sounds of the waves. We especially loved having a rear facing balcony because we felt we had the best view. We could see both the left and the right side of port while pulling in, and we had the most spectacular view of the islands as we left port each evening. We felt the over all size of the room was great and we had no issues getting around. I was surprised with how much storage there was in our room and there was definitely enough room to store all our things.
